Kirsimarja Koskinen
Kirsimarja Koskinen (born 11 April 1969) is a Finnish taekwondo practitioner. She was born in Helsinki.[1]

Career
Koskinen won a silver medal at the 1990 European championships, and bronze medal in 1994 and 1996. She participated at the World Taekwondo Championships eight times, first time in 1989.[2] She competed at the 2000 Summer Olympics in Sydney.[1]
